About the Kareri Lake trek:

Located at about 2,950 meters in the Kangra district of Himachal Pradesh, Kareri Lake is a freshwater lake rugged amidst mountains with greenery all around. Situated in the majestic Dhauladhar range, this glacial Kareri lake trek will take you through a journey of the most scenic views as it is home to lush pasturelands, exotic perennial flowers, and dense conifers. How to Reach:

By Air: Kangra Airport is the Nearest Airport just 17 Km from Dharamkot. You can get here by connecting flights from New Delhi and Chandigarh Airports.

By Train: The nearest railway station is at Kangra which is 27 Km from Dharamkot. It is connected to Pathankot Railway Station through a narrow-gauge line.

By Road: Overnight buses run from New Delhi to Mcleodganj from where Dharamkot is just 4 Km. You can also get buses to Mcleodganj from Shimla, Manali, Dehradun, Chandigarh, and Pathankot.

2. Trek to Kareri Lake | Walk through thick forests of Oak, Rhododendron, and Pine trees

  • Start off early in the morning after having a hearty breakfast.
  • From Kareri Village, you will go to Reoti Base Camp, and from here you will start the trek to the lake.
  • Trek to the lake from Reoti depends on weather conditions as on a rainy day the path becomes too slippery and dangerous for trekking.
  • The trek first passes through level grounds but then comes onto a steep ascent, as you trek alongside the Kareri Nullah Stream and pass through various bridges.
  • Get immersed in the beauty of nature as you look at the perfect elliptical glacial lake surrounded by subtropical forests and alpine grasslands.
  • To get a better view of the lake climb the nearby hill with the temple on top where you can rest for a while.
  • After some time start your trek back to the Reoti Base Camp where you can enjoy a campfire.
  • Overnight at the Reoti Base Camp.
